Nokia

Software Development Engineer (5G NR, C++, Embedded)

Nokia Ulm

Stellenbeschreibung:

Software Development Engineer (5G NR, C++, Embedded)

Get AI-powered advice on this job and more exclusive features.

Job Description

At Nokia, we create technology that helps the world act together. As a global leader in wireless mobility networks, we are at the forefront of 5G innovation, with over 3,500 patent families essential for 5G. Our mission is to build a more connected, inclusive, and sustainable world.

Join our 5G L2 Software Development team in Ulm, where we are creating the heart of the next‑generation 5G base station. Together, we are building the best 5G gNB Packet Scheduler on the market, driven by a culture of collaboration, openness, and continuous improvement.

How You Will Contribute And What You Will Learn

As a Software Development Engineer, you will play a key role in shaping the future of 5G technology. You will:

  • Design, implement, and maintain real‑time software for 5G base station embedded systems.
  • Collaborate with your team to refine, estimate, and plan sprint work.
  • Ensure high‑quality code through unit/component testing and code reviews.
  • Analyze and resolve software defects to continuously improve our products.
  • Contribute to the development of cutting‑edge packet scheduling algorithms for the Nokia 5G product family.

Key Skills And Experience

We value diverse perspectives and are committed to building an inclusive workplace. If you meet the following qualifications, we encourage you to apply:

Must‑have qualifications

  • Proficiency in C++14 (or newer), Python, and shell scripting.
  • Experience developing software in a Linux environment.
  • A basic understanding of 5G New Radio (NR) or LTE channels, protocols, and procedures.
  • A bachelor’s or master’s degree in electrical engineering, telecommunications, or computer science.

Nice to have

  • Familiarity with Agile software development and tools like Git, Gerrit, GTest, and GMock.
  • Knowledge of Clean Code principles and SOLID design principles.
  • Experience with software testing concepts (e.g., unit test, component test, test‑driven development, continuous integration, test automation).
  • Understanding of real‑time software on multi‑core embedded systems.
  • Interest in AI and Machine Learning strategies and their application.

Why Nokia?

  • Impactful Work: Contribute to world‑changing technology that connects people and powers industries.
  • Career Growth: Access to continuous learning opportunities, mentoring, and career development programs.
  • Inclusive Culture: Be part of a diverse, collaborative, and supportive team that values your unique perspective.
  • Flexibility: Enjoy a healthy work‑life balance with flexible working arrangements.

Ready to join us?

If you’re passionate about innovation, teamwork, and making a difference, we’d love to hear from you. Apply today and help us shape the future of 5G!

Nokia is committed to equality and is an equal‑opportunity employer. We welcome applications from candidates of all backgrounds, including those from underrepresented groups.

About Us

Advancing connectivity to secure a brighter world.

Nokia is a global leader in connectivity for the AI era. With expertise across fixed, mobile and transport networks, powered by the innovation of Nokia Bell Labs, we’re advancing connectivity to secure a brighter world.

Learn more about life at Nokia.

Our recruitment process

We act inclusively and respect the uniqueness of people. Our employment decisions are made regardless of race, color, national or ethnic origin, religion, gender, sexual orientation, gender identity or expression, age, marital status, disability, protected veteran status or other characteristics protected by law. We are committed to a culture of inclusion built upon our core value of respect.

If you’re interested in this role but don’t meet every listed requirement, we still encourage you to apply. Unique backgrounds, perspectives, and experiences enrich our teams, and you may be just the right candidate for this or another opportunity.

The length of the recruitment process may vary depending on the specific role’s requirements. We strive to ensure a smooth and inclusive experience for all candidates. Discover more about the recruitment process at Nokia.

#J-18808-Ljbffr
NOTE / HINWEIS:
EnglishEN: Please refer to Fuchsjobs for the source of your application
DeutschDE: Bitte erwähne Fuchsjobs, als Quelle Deiner Bewerbung

Stelleninformationen

  • Veröffentlichungsdatum:

    17 Jan 2026
  • Standort:

    Ulm
  • Typ:

    Vollzeit
  • Arbeitsmodell:

    Vor Ort
  • Kategorie:

  • Erfahrung:

    2+ years
  • Arbeitsverhältnis:

    Angestellt

KI Suchagent

AI job search

Möchtest über ähnliche Jobs informiert werden? Dann beauftrage jetzt den Fuchsjobs KI Suchagenten!

Diese Jobs passen zu Deiner Suche:

company logo
Servicetechniker (m/w/d)
Chromos GmbH
Vollzeit Düsseldorf
22 Jan 2026Development & IT
company logo
Technischer Support (m/w/d)
Metreg Technologies GmbH
Vollzeit Remseck am Neckar
21 Jan 2026Development & IT
ESWE Versorgungs AG
Elektroniker für Informations- und Telekommunikationstechnik (m/w/d)
ESWE Versorgungs AG
Vollzeit Wiesbaden
12 Jan 2026Development & IT
HAURATON GmbH & Co. KG
Team Leader IT-Infrastructure (m/w/d)
HAURATON GmbH & Co. KG
Vollzeit Rastatt
12 Jan 2026Development & IT
company logo
Fachinformatiker Systeme und Prozesse (m/w/d) Vollzeit / Teilzeit
Stadtwerke Schrobenhausen
Teilzeit Schrobenhausen
21 Jan 2026Development & IT
Rail Management Consultants International GmbH
Softwareentwickler C++ (m/w/d) für Datenbankprogrammierung und Web-Services
Rail Management Consultants International GmbH
partner ad:img
Vollzeit Hannover
25 Jan 2026Development & IT
Manufactum GmbH
SAP FI/CO Inhouse Consultant (m/w/d)
Manufactum GmbH
partner ad:img
Vollzeit Waltrop
25 Jan 2026Development & IT
ams Sensors Germany GmbH
Senior Staff Analog IC Design Engineer (d/m/f)
ams Sensors Germany GmbH
partner ad:img
Vollzeit Jena
26 Jan 2026Development & IT